The Toronto Maple Leafs found themselves on the wrong side of a narrow defeat against the Boston Bruins, and the post-game conversation has taken a negative turn.

Following a controversial takedown of Timothy Liljegren by Bruins captain Brad Marchand, expectations were high for the Maple Leafs to respond and stand up for their fallen teammate. Surprisingly, no one, not even the typically physical Ryan Reaves, stepped in.

Instead, what unfolded was a scene of players on the Leafs' bench taunting Marchand without any on-ice retaliation. Notably, the focus of this interaction seemed to center around one player.




A glaring reaction



In the video footage, Tyler Bertuzzi, a recent addition to the Leafs, was seen wearing a smile as Marchand confidently glided past the bench, knowing that no retribution was imminent. This visual has drawn sharp criticism from the Leafs fan base.

"I won't explain myself. People can interpret it as they wish,"
Bertuzzi responded, unswayed by the backlash.


While Bertuzzi remains unruffled by the fan response, the pressure is mounting as he has managed just three points in the team's initial ten games. Leafs fans are hopeful that he will elevate his performance on the ice and give them less reason to voice their concerns.
